An integrative model of leukocyte genomics and organ dysfunction in heart failure patients requiring mechanical circulatory support

2015-08-14

Abstract excerpt

<h4>Background</h4> The implantation of mechanical circulatory support (MCS) devices in heart failure patients is associated with a systemic inflammatory response, potentially leading to death from multiple organ dysfunction syndrome. Previous studies point to the involvement of many mechanisms, but an integrative hypothesis does not yet exist. Using time-dependent whole-genome mRNA expression in circulating leuk...
